I like the rooms in the Cal west tower best. The bathrooms are fully enclosed, inside they contain the tub/shower, toilet and vanity. At MSS the bathrooms is split into 2 parts, one "room" contains the tub/shower and toilet and the other area contains the vanity. The standard room at the Cal also has a table with 2 chairs so isn't much different than MSS.
If I had an option I would rather stay at the Cal. Parking lot is connected to the hotel so you don't have to go outside or get wet walking from the parking structure to the hotel. The walk to your room isn't as far as at MSS, especially if you are coming from the FSE. At MSS you have to walk all the way to the back of the hotel, take the elevator and then walk the corridor back to your room. For me I find it easy at the Cal to get to my room. The noise from the trains or freeway isn't as loud at the Cal as at MSS (IMHO). Unlike other posters, if you have a MSS room near the tracks it may bother you if you are a light sleeper.
But I don't think you will go wrong with either hotel, at MSS just ask for a room facing south so you don't encounter the noise from the freeway. In the Cal west tower, ask for a room facing west so you get some view. I wouldn't recommend an inside room at the Cal, you are facing either the east or west tower so no view other than the rooms in the other wing.
For me my first choice for downtown is the Cal and the second choice is MSS so both places aren't much different.
